一种热词的推荐方法、装置、电子设备及存储介质制造方法及图纸

技术编号:23288256 阅读:17 留言:0更新日期:2020-02-08 18:16
本申请公开了一种热词的推荐方法、装置、电子设备及存储介质,在众多帖子中筛选出高评分帖子,并根据主题词库中每个主题词的父子关系构建树形主题词库,将高评分帖子和树形主题词库进行关联,得到树形热词库。树形热词库中包括热度较高的帖子和与其关联的热词,因此,以树形热词库作为搜索依据,并与用户画像提供的多个标签词进行匹配,即可准确确定出推荐热词,用户可通过该推荐热词查看与其关联的帖子。可见,该方法通过构建树形热词库和用户画像,可以为用户精准匹配出关联性较强的推荐热词,将该推荐热词推荐给用户,该推荐热词对应的帖子为用户感兴趣的几率较大。

Recommended method, device, electronic equipment and storage medium of a hot word

【技术实现步骤摘要】
一种热词的推荐方法、装置、电子设备及存储介质
本申请涉及计算机应用
,尤其涉及一种热词的推荐方法、装置、电子设备及存储介质。
技术介绍
由于人们对快速、准确地获取信息的需求不断增加,基于人工智能和自然语言处理领域的问答系统逐渐兴起。问答系统(QuestionAnsweringSystem,QA)是信息检索系统的一种高级形式,它能用准确、简洁的自然语言回答用户用自然语言提出的问题。问答系统除具有回答问题的基础功能之外,还可为用户推荐一些问答热词,以引导用户点击并获取问答热词对应的相关信息。现有的问答系统通常采用搜索所设词库的方式为用户进行推荐,该词库根据使用问答系统的所有用户的历史搜索时所使用的关键词生成。在为用户推荐问答热词时,问答系统在词库中选取在最近一段时间内出现次数较多的关键词作为问答热词推荐给用户。但是,问答系统根据其他用户的历史搜索关键词进行推荐,那么推荐的问答热词可能会与当前用户的需求或偏好不同,使得推荐的问答热词并非用户感兴趣的内容。
技术实现思路
本专利技术提供了一种热词的推荐方法、装置、电子设备及存储介质,以解决现有的推荐方法无法准确地推荐热词的问题。第一方面,本专利技术提供了一种热词的推荐方法,包括以下步骤:获取主题词库和多个帖子;在多个所述帖子中筛选出高评分帖子;根据所述主题词库中每个主题词的父子关系,构建树形主题词库;将所述高评分帖子与树形主题词库进行关联,得到树形热词库;获取用户的用户画像,所述用户画像用于提供所述用户的多个标签词;将每个所述标签词分别与树形热词库中的热词进行匹配,确定与所述标签词匹配的热词作为推荐热词;将所述推荐热词推荐给用户。进一步地,所述在多个帖子中筛选出高评分帖子,包括:对每个所述帖子进行打分,得到每个帖子的排序系数;选取所述排序系数大于预设分数阈值的帖子为高评分帖子。进一步地,所述将高评分帖子与树形主题词库进行关联,得到树形热词库,包括:获取所述帖子的索引,所述索引包括多个关键词;将所述关键词与树形主题词库中的主题词进行匹配;根据匹配的关键词与主题词建立关联关系,合并所述高评分帖子和树形主题词库,得到树形热词库。进一步地,所述将每个标签词分别与树形热词库中的热词进行匹配,确定与所述标签词匹配的热词作为推荐热词,包括:将每个所述标签词分别与树形热词库中子节点对应的热词进行匹配;如果存在所述标签词与子节点对应的热词相同时,将匹配相同的热词作为推荐热词。进一步地,还包括:统计所述用户画像提供的标签词的数量,以及,根据所述标签词与子节点对应的热词进行匹配确定的推荐热词的数量;如果所述推荐热词的数量少于标签词的数量,将标签词与树形热词库中兄弟节点对应的热词进行匹配,直至所述推荐热词的数量与标签词的数量相等时匹配结束,所述兄弟节点指的是子节点的兄弟节点。进一步地,还包括:如果所述标签词与树形热词库中所有兄弟节点对应的热词均匹配后,所述推荐热词的数量仍小于标签词的数量,则结束匹配过程。第二方面,本申请还提供了一种热词的推荐装置,包括:信息获取模块,用于获取主题词库和多个帖子;筛选模块,用于在多个所述帖子中筛选出高评分帖子;树形主题词库构建模块,用于根据所述主题词库中每个主题词的父子关系,构建树形主题词库;树形热词库构建模块,用于将所述高评分帖子与树形主题词库进行关联,得到树形热词库;用户画像获取模块,用于获取用户的用户画像,所述用户画像用于提供所述用户的多个标签词;推荐热词确定模块,用于将每个所述标签词分别与树形热词库中的热词进行匹配,确定与所述标签词匹配的热词作为推荐热词;推荐模块,用于将所述推荐热词推荐给用户。进一步地,所述筛选模块,包括:打分单元,用于对每个所述帖子进行打分,得到每个帖子的排序系数;选取单元,用于选取所述排序系数大于预设分数阈值的帖子为高评分帖子。进一步地,所述树形热词库构建模块,包括:索引获取单元,用于获取所述帖子的索引,所述索引包括多个关键词;第一匹配单元,用于将所述关键词与树形主题词库中的主题词进行匹配;树形热词库构建单元,用于根据匹配的关键词与主题词建立关联关系,合并所述高评分帖子和树形主题词库,得到树形热词库。进一步地,所述推荐热词确定模块,包括:第二匹配单元,用于将每个所述标签词分别与树形热词库中子节点对应的热词进行匹配;推荐热词确定单元,用于在存在所述标签词与子节点对应的热词相同时,将匹配相同的热词作为推荐热词。进一步地,还包括:数量统计单元,用于统计所述用户画像提供的标签词的数量,以及,根据所述标签词与子节点对应的热词进行匹配确定的推荐热词的数量;第三匹配单元,用于在所述推荐热词的数量少于标签词的数量时,将标签词与树形热词库中兄弟节点对应的热词进行匹配,直至所述推荐热词的数量与标签词的数量相等时匹配结束,所述兄弟节点指的是子节点的兄弟节点。进一步地,还包括:第四匹配单元,用于在所述标签词与树形热词库中所有兄弟节点对应的热词均匹配后,所述推荐热词的数量仍小于标签词的数量,则结束匹配过程。第三方面,本专利技术实施例还提供了一种电子设备,包括:存储器,用于存储程序指令;处理器,用于调用并执行所述存储器中的程序指令,以实现第一方面所述的热词的推荐方法。第四方面,本专利技术实施例还提供了一种存储介质,所述存储介质中存储有计算机程序,当热词的推荐装置的至少一个处理器执行所述计算机程序时,热词的推荐装置执行第一方面所述的热词的推荐方法。由以上技术方案可知,本专利技术实施例提供的一种热词的推荐方法、装置、电子设备及存储介质,在众多帖子中筛选出高评分帖子,并根据主题词库中每个主题词的父子关系构建树形主题词库,将高评分帖子和树形主题词库进行关联,得到树形热词库。树形热词库中包括热度较高的帖子和与其关联的热词,因此,以树形热词库作为搜索依据,并与用户画像提供的多个标签词进行匹配,即可准确确定出推荐热词,用户可通过该推荐热词查看与其关联的帖子。可见,该方法通过构建树形热词库和用户画像,可以为用户精准匹配出关联性较强的推荐热词,将该推荐热词推荐给用户,该推荐热词对应的帖子为用户感兴趣的几率较大。附图说明为了更清楚地说明本申请的技术方案,下面将对实施例中所需要使用的附图作简单地介绍,显而易见地,对于本领域普通技术人员而言,在不付出创造性劳动性的前提下,还可以根据这些附图获得其他的附图。图1为本专利技术实施例提供的热词的推荐方法的流程图;图2为本专利技术实施例提供的筛选高评分帖子的方法流程图;图3为本专利技术实施例提供的创建树形热词库的方法流程图;图4为本专利技术实施例提供的确定推荐热词的方法流程图;图5为本专利技术实施例提供的热词的推荐本文档来自技高网...

【技术保护点】
1.一种热词的推荐方法,其特征在于,包括以下步骤:/n获取主题词库和多个帖子;/n在多个所述帖子中筛选出高评分帖子;/n根据所述主题词库中每个主题词的父子关系,构建树形主题词库;/n将所述高评分帖子与树形主题词库进行关联,得到树形热词库;/n获取用户的用户画像,所述用户画像用于提供所述用户的多个标签词;/n将每个所述标签词分别与树形热词库中的热词进行匹配,确定与所述标签词匹配的热词作为推荐热词;/n将所述推荐热词推荐给用户。/n

【技术特征摘要】
1.一种热词的推荐方法,其特征在于,包括以下步骤:
获取主题词库和多个帖子;
在多个所述帖子中筛选出高评分帖子;
根据所述主题词库中每个主题词的父子关系,构建树形主题词库;
将所述高评分帖子与树形主题词库进行关联,得到树形热词库;
获取用户的用户画像,所述用户画像用于提供所述用户的多个标签词;
将每个所述标签词分别与树形热词库中的热词进行匹配,确定与所述标签词匹配的热词作为推荐热词;
将所述推荐热词推荐给用户。


2.根据权利要求1所述的方法,其特征在于,所述在多个帖子中筛选出高评分帖子,包括:
对每个所述帖子进行打分,得到每个帖子的排序系数;
选取所述排序系数大于预设分数阈值的帖子为高评分帖子。


3.根据权利要求1所述的方法,其特征在于,所述将高评分帖子与树形主题词库进行关联,得到树形热词库,包括:
获取所述帖子的索引,所述索引包括多个关键词;
将所述关键词与树形主题词库中的主题词进行匹配;
根据匹配的关键词与主题词建立关联关系,合并所述高评分帖子和树形主题词库,得到树形热词库。


4.根据权利要求1所述的方法,其特征在于,所述将每个标签词分别与树形热词库中的热词进行匹配,确定与所述标签词匹配的热词作为推荐热词,包括:
将每个所述标签词分别与树形热词库中子节点对应的热词进行匹配;
如果存在所述标签词与子节点对应的热词相同时,将匹配相同的热词作为推荐热词。


5.根据权利要求4所述的方法,其特征在于,还包括:
统计所述用户画像提供的标签词的数量,以及,根据所述标签词与子节点对应的热词进行匹配确定的推荐热词的数量;
如果所述推荐热词的数量少于标签词的数量,将标签词与树形热词库中兄弟节点对应的热词进行匹配,直至所述推荐热词的数量与标签词的数量相等时匹配结束,所述兄弟节点指的是子节点的兄弟节点。


6.根据权利要求5所述的方法,其特征在于,还包括:
如果所述标签词与树形热词库中所有兄弟节点对应的热词均匹配后,所述推荐热词的数量仍小于标签词的数量,则结束匹配过程。


7.一种热词的推荐装置,其特征在于,包括:
信息获取模块,用于获取主题词库和多个帖子;
筛选模块,用于在多个所述帖子中筛选出高评分帖子;
树形主题词库构建模块,用于根据所述主题词库中每个主题词的父子关系,构建树形主题词库;
树形热词库构建模块,用于将所述高评分帖子...

【专利技术属性】
技术研发人员:李洋
申请(专利权)人:五八有限公司
类型:发明
国别省市:天津;12

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1